Ian has a leadership role in the delivery of structural engineering projects for the Calgary office, and contributes to resource management, quality assurance, and the mentoring of staff across offices.

When managing and leading projects at Entuitive, Ian enjoys being involved from conceptual design through to construction. He is able to dive in and assist colleagues thanks to 17 years’ experience as a structural engineering consultant.

Ian’s diverse portfolio includes three of Toronto’s preeminent cultural centres: the National Ballet School of Canada, the Royal Conservatory of Music, and the Four Seasons Centre for the Performing Arts. Ian’s diverse portfolio includes high-profile projects in the low-rise commercial, sports and recreation, institutional, low and high-rise residential, hospitality, municipal, transportation, light industrial and retail sectors. Beyond Canada, Ian’s career has taken him to Cayman Islands, Greece and Namibia.
